About this school
Contentnea - Savannah School is
a rural public school
in Kinston, North Carolina that is part of Lenoir County Public Schools.
It serves 769 students
in grades K - 8 with a student/teacher ratio of 13.7:1.
Its teachers have had 524 projects funded on DonorsChoose.
